
程序代码如何启动系统
常见问答
程序代码启动系统的基础步骤有哪些?
我想了解启动系统时,程序代码通常需要执行哪些基础步骤?
启动系统时程序代码的基础步骤
程序代码在启动系统时,通常需要完成硬件初始化、加载引导程序、启动内核以及初始化必要的系统服务。这些步骤有助于确保系统资源准备就绪,处理器处于正确模式,并为应用程序提供运行环境。
如何通过代码控制系统启动顺序?
在编写用于启动系统的程序代码时,有哪些方法可以控制不同组件的启动顺序?
控制系统启动顺序的方法
通过设计启动脚本或配置启动管理器,可以设置不同服务或模块的加载顺序。此外,编写程序时可以使用依赖管理机制,确保某些关键服务先于其他组件启动,保证系统整体的稳定和效率。
调试启动系统的程序代码时有哪些常见问题?
在调试用于启动操作系统的程序代码时,常见会遇到哪些问题?该如何解决?
启动系统代码调试中的常见问题及解决方案
常见问题包括硬件初始化失败、引导程序加载错误、内核崩溃或挂起等。解决方法涉及检查硬件连接、验证引导加载器配置、使用调试工具跟踪内核启动过程,并查看日志获取详细错误信息。保持代码和配置的正确性对排查问题非常关键。